Learn How to Make an Easy Origami Crane

Origami is a wonderful hobby that allows you to create intriguing shapes from a ordinary piece of paper. One of the most famous origami creations is the crane, a symbol of peace and longevity. Making an origami crane is surprisingly easy, even for novices.

  • First creasing a square piece of paper in half across the corner.
  • Afterwards, unfold the paper and repeat with the other corner.
  • Continue by folding the paper in half vertically.
  • Open up the paper and then fold it in half top to bottom.
  • This will give you a square with several creases inside.

An Classic Origami Crane: A Timeless Art Form

The origami crane, a symbol of harmony, has been cherished for centuries. This graceful structure is said to bring good luck and frequently crafted on special occasions.

The process of shaping a crane from a simple square of paper demands patience, precision, and a keen eye for detail. Each fold contributes to the final result.

As a age-old art form, origami cranes continue to inspire people of all ages and backgrounds.
